Core Viewpoint - The People's Bank of China (PBOC) emphasizes the importance of maintaining financial stability and supporting the real economy while enhancing financial regulation and reform since November 2024 [1] Group 1: Monetary Policy - The PBOC plans to implement a moderately loose monetary policy to create a favorable financial environment for economic recovery, ensuring that social financing and money supply growth align with economic growth and price expectations [2] - The central bank aims to enhance the efficiency of fund utilization and maintain liquidity while managing interest rates and preventing excessive fluctuations in the exchange rate [2] Group 2: Financial Regulation - There will be a focus on strengthening and improving financial regulation, including addressing irrational competition among financial institutions and enhancing consumer protection [2][3] - The PBOC will implement a comprehensive regulatory framework to combat illegal financial activities and improve the legal framework governing finance [2][3] Group 3: Financial Services to the Real Economy - The PBOC will prioritize high-quality financial services to support key sectors such as technology innovation, consumption, small and micro enterprises, and foreign trade [3] - Financial institutions are encouraged to enhance their specialized capabilities to better serve these sectors [3] Group 4: Structural Reforms - The PBOC will continue to deepen supply-side structural reforms in finance, including improving the central bank's system and enhancing the transmission mechanism of monetary policy [3] - There will be a push for the development of the bond market and reforms in the stock market to promote high-quality growth in direct financing [3] Group 5: Financial Openness and Security - The PBOC aims to advance high-level financial openness while ensuring national financial security, including promoting the internationalization of the Renminbi and enhancing its global functions [4] - The central bank will also focus on building a cross-border payment system and monitoring international economic trends that may impact China [4] Group 6: Risk Prevention - The PBOC will strengthen the monitoring and assessment of systemic financial risks and support the market-oriented transformation of financing platforms [4] - Efforts will be made to improve the financing system in line with new real estate development models and enhance the governance of small and medium-sized financial institutions [4]
